Blokzijl is a city located southwest of Steenwijk in the province of Overijssel, the Netherlands. Blokzijl grew in the 1580s. During the siege of Steenwijk, the Dutch built there a fortified lock or in local dialect zijl or siel. It received city rights in 1672. Until 1973, it was a separate municipality; it is now part of Steenwijkerland.
